Evidence
|
Dap2 was identified as an anti-defense factor through infection assays using a Δdap2 mutant of phage PaoP5. Deletion of dap2 (ECO_0001038) reduced phage burst size and resulted in smaller plaques in Pseudomonas aeruginosa PAO1, independent of the T3SS system, indicating an additional anti-defense function. Pull-down assays (ECO_0006249) and mass spectrometry identified Lon protease as a Dap2 binding partner (ECO_0001096).
